At Databricks, we design tools that make complex data workflows intuitive and powerful. Our mission is to simplify how data is connected, understood, and activated so that organizations can turn information into business outcomes. Designers at Databricks blend strong visual craft with systems thinking, shaping products that support some of the most advanced data teams in the world.

 

We're hiring a Staff Product Designer to help build a new product category at Databricks. You will help shape agent-driven experiences that make the power of the Lakehouse accessible to a broader set of users.  This will be a true 0-to-1 environment, combining the excitement of a startup with the resources of a tech leader like Databricks.


The impact you will have

  • Drive key product and design initiatives within a strategic new product area at Databricks, helping organizations activate and operationalize their data at scale.
  • Define a new generation of agent-driven workflows that help users move seamlessly from data and insights to decisions and action.
  • Collaborate closely with product management, engineering, and leadership to shape the future of business applications on the Databricks platform.
  • Design intuitive user experiences that simplify complex workflows while preserving the flexibility and power required by enterprise organizations.
  • Develop a deep understanding of Databricks business objectives, customer needs, emerging AI capabilities, and the evolving data and technology landscape.
  • Conduct user research to identify customer needs, pain points, and opportunities related to data activation, and AI-assisted workflows.
  • Mentor junior designers, fostering their growth and development within our team.

What we look for

  • 8+ years of product design work experience
  • A bachelor's or master’s degree in design, computer science, human-computer interaction, or related field
  • Demonstrated ability to lead large and complex design projects and balance the needs of diverse stakeholders
  • Can execute beautiful visual and interaction work that’s rooted in a data-driven, and well-researched UX process
  • A system thinker who has the vision to design the big picture, and the tactical ability to break it down so that engineering can succeed in building it incrementally
  • You have a unique combination of technical knowledge and visual design skills which allows you to design powerful and intuitive tooling for technical users.
  • A portfolio demonstrating your end-to-end design process, from inception to production
  • Experience designing products that bridge the gap between technical and business users is a strong plus. Familiarity with data, analytics, AI, or enterprise software is highly valued.
  • The strongest candidates have demonstrated experience using modern development and AI-assisted coding tools to prototype ideas, understand implementation tradeoffs, and collaborate deeply with engineering teams.

About Databricks

Databricks is the data and AI company. More than 10,000 organizations worldwide — including Comcast, Condé Nast, Grammarly, and over 50% of the Fortune 500 — rely on the Databricks Data Intelligence Platform to unify and democratize data, analytics and AI. Databricks is headquartered in San Francisco, with offices around the globe and was founded by the original creators of Lakehouse, Apache Spark™, Delta Lake and MLflow. What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
